4 Easy Ways to Maintain a Great Resume
Tweet Share on Facebook September 2, 2010 CommentIf you are like most people I talk to every day, keeping your resume current isn't at the top of the priority list. People usually think about their resume only when they are actively looking for work or when a job comes up that piques their interest. But if you have to spend a few days writing a new one, it could mean someone else gets the job before you have the opportunity to apply, or the recruiter moves on to the next person. You also risk forgetting some of those valuable accomplishments to add to your resume.
